HIM –> Drive

To download a parameter profile from the
HIM to a drive, you must have a Series B
HIM.

Important: The download function will only be
available when there is a valid profile stored
in the HIM.

From the EEProm menu, press the
Increment/Decrement keys until “HIM –>
Drive” is displayed.

Press the Enter key. A profile name will
be displayed on line 2 of the HIM.
Pressing the Increment/Decrement keys
will scroll the display to a second profile
(if available).

Once the desired profile name is dis-
played, press the Enter key. An informa-
tional display will be shown, indicating
the version numbers of the profile and
drive.

Press Enter to start the download. The
parameter number currently being
downloaded will be displayed on line 1 of
the HIM. Line 2 will indicate total
progress. Press ESC to stop the download.

A successful download will be indicated
by “COMPLETE” displayed on line 2 of
the HIM. Press Enter. If “ERROR” is
displayed, see Chapter 6.
